Commit Graph

  • b178c46be7 cmd/connector-gen: reduce the routes for github fran/appc-ensmallen-gh-preset Fran Bull 2024-05-02 12:27:59 -0700
  • f97d0ac994 net/dns/resolver: add better error wrapping Andrew Dunham 2024-05-02 12:28:38 -0400
  • e0287a4b33
    wgengine: add exit destination logging enable for wgengine logger (#11952) Claire Wang 2024-05-02 13:55:05 -0400
  • 5bb3a0e3b9 wgengine: add exit destination logging enable for wgengine logger Updates tailscale/corp#18625 Co-authored-by: Kevin Liang <kevinliang@tailscale.com> Signed-off-by: Claire Wang <claire@tailscale.com> Claire Wang 2024-04-26 21:16:25 -0400
  • d6cc2666eb k8s-operator/apis/v1alpha1: update DNSConfig description irbekrm/dnsconfigdocs Irbe Krumina 2024-05-02 14:58:01 +0100
  • 3e50addb2d wasm/js: correctly handle non standard https port for custom control server websocket url nom3ad 2024-05-02 22:03:20 +0530
  • 6979706fd9 go.mod.sri: update SRI hash for go.mod changes flakes Flakes Updater 2024-05-02 16:30:36 +0000
  • 19b31ac9a6
    cmd/{k8s-operator,k8s-nameserver},k8s-operator: update nameserver config with records for ingress/egress proxies (#11019) Irbe Krumina 2024-05-02 17:29:46 +0100
  • c32721f3dc net/dns/resolver: add better error wrapping Andrew Dunham 2024-05-02 12:28:38 -0400
  • a49ed2e145 derp,ipn/ipnlocal: stop calling rand.Seed Maisem Ali 2024-05-01 23:51:24 -0700
  • 1c10ec8be6 derp,ipn/ipnlocal: stop calling rand.Seed Maisem Ali 2024-05-01 23:51:24 -0700
  • ccc94c3d04 ipnlocal, magicsock: store last suggested exit node id in local backend Updates tailscale/corp#19681 Claire Wang 2024-04-30 20:24:38 -0400
  • 0bfaaa5d04 code review feedback Irbe Krumina 2024-05-02 13:38:58 +0100
  • 541cdd7267
    drive: use secret token to authenticate access to file server on localhost Percy Wegmann 2024-05-02 06:35:10 -0500
  • e5a7b55ea2
    Ineffective attempt making sftp work with pam ox/11854-3-sftp Percy Wegmann 2024-05-01 19:31:15 -0500
  • 96712e10a7 health, ipn/ipnlocal: move more health warning code into health.Tracker Brad Fitzpatrick 2024-05-01 13:54:56 -0700
  • 2cc47f441c
    ssh/tailssh: fall back to using su when no TTY available on Linux Percy Wegmann 2024-04-29 09:49:33 -0500
  • b839a1bb6c
    drive: use secret token to authenticate access to file server on localhost Percy Wegmann 2024-05-01 15:57:06 -0500
  • 269471e5b4 health, ipn/ipnlocal: move more health warning code into health.Tracker Brad Fitzpatrick 2024-05-01 13:54:56 -0700
  • 05c01f1e23
    drive: use secret token to authenticate access to file server on localhost Percy Wegmann 2024-05-01 14:38:01 -0500
  • a7272b7e75
    drive: use secret token to authenticate access to file server on localhost Percy Wegmann 2024-05-01 14:27:49 -0500
  • 1882c5d40e tstest/integration: mark TestControlTimeLogLine as flaky Andrew Dunham 2024-05-01 15:24:15 -0400
  • be663c84c1 net/tstun: rename natConfig to peerConfig Andrew Dunham 2024-04-30 18:33:59 -0400
  • 39e6649b63 tstest/integration: mark TestTwoNodes as flaky Andrew Dunham 2024-05-01 14:56:56 -0400
  • 59d5e5f0b9 net/tstun: rename natConfig to peerConfig Andrew Dunham 2024-04-30 18:33:59 -0400
  • 10497acc95 net/tstun: refactor natConfig to not be per-family Andrew Dunham 2024-04-30 18:29:27 -0400
  • 9300c8effe
    drive: don't allow DELETE on read-only shares percy/cherry-pick-2648d475d751b47755958f47a366e300b6b6de0a Percy Wegmann 2024-04-30 20:31:49 -0500
  • ec5c41addc net/tstun: refactor natConfig to not be per-family Andrew Dunham 2024-04-30 18:29:27 -0400
  • f83e3479ed
    Merge 0360ca0790 into 13e1355546 dependabot[bot] 2024-05-01 17:09:17 +0000
  • 2d3fbb9700
    Merge 4b2dabb54e into 13e1355546 dependabot[bot] 2024-05-01 17:09:15 +0000
  • 13e1355546
    scripts/installer.sh: remove unnecessary escaping in grep (#11950) Andrew Lytvynov 2024-05-01 10:09:10 -0700
  • f7e94c6b71
    scripts/installer.sh: remove unnecessary escaping in grep Andrew Lytvynov 2024-04-30 19:33:23 -0700
  • 843afe7c53 ssh/tailssh: add integration test Percy Wegmann 2024-04-28 10:42:10 -0500
  • 45b9aa0d83
    net/netmon: remove spammy log statements (#11953) Jonathan Nobels 2024-05-01 12:02:16 -0400
  • 4c08410011 cmd/tailscale/cli: set localClient.UseSocketOnly during flag parsing Paul Scott 2024-05-01 16:24:55 +0100
  • ba34943133 cmd/tailscale/cli/ffcomplete: omit and clean completion results Paul Scott 2024-05-01 16:14:45 +0100
  • d32e85894d
    drive: use secret token to authenticate access to file server on localhost Percy Wegmann 2024-05-01 10:45:57 -0500
  • bccac78cf9 cmd/tailscale/cli: set localClient.UseSocketOnly during flag parsing Paul Scott 2024-05-01 16:24:55 +0100
  • 382a95c8e5 cmd/tailscale/cli/ffcomplete: omit and clean completion results Paul Scott 2024-05-01 16:14:45 +0100
  • d8e68c4600
    ssh/tailssh: add integration test Percy Wegmann 2024-04-28 10:42:10 -0500
  • c30db1d1fb net/netmon: remove spammy log statements Jonathan Nobels 2024-05-01 10:09:52 -0400
  • fa1303d632
    net/netmon: swap to swift-derived defaultRoute on macos (#11936) Jonathan Nobels 2024-05-01 09:20:09 -0400
  • f3ff26f08f net/netmon: swap to swift-derived defaultRoute on macos Jonathan Nobels 2024-04-26 12:21:43 -0400
  • de85610be0
    cmd/k8s-operator/deploy/chart: allow users to configure additional labels for the operator's Pod via Helm chart values. Gabe Gorelick 2024-05-01 05:37:21 -0400
  • 2648d475d7 drive: don't allow DELETE on read-only shares Percy Wegmann 2024-04-30 20:31:49 -0500
  • a3de105f0e
    drive: don't allow DELETE on read-only shares Percy Wegmann 2024-04-30 20:31:49 -0500
  • 5c918f9ea0 cmd/k8s-operator/deploy/chart: podLabels Gabe Gorelick 2024-04-30 20:29:30 -0400
  • 7455e027e9 util/slicesx: add AppendMatching Brad Fitzpatrick 2024-04-30 16:36:41 -0700
  • 787c4be2e3 util/slicesx: add AppendMatching Brad Fitzpatrick 2024-04-30 16:36:41 -0700
  • fe009c134e ipn/ipnlocal: reset the dialPlan only when the URL is unchanged Andrew Dunham 2024-04-30 15:09:12 -0400
  • c47f9303b0 types/views: use slices.Contains{,Func} Brad Fitzpatrick 2024-04-30 15:25:06 -0700
  • 1de4ecbb3d types/views: use slices.Contains{,Func} Brad Fitzpatrick 2024-04-30 15:25:06 -0700
  • 5db80cf2d8
    syncs: fix AtomicValue for interface kinds (#11943) Joe Tsai 2024-04-30 14:27:58 -0700
  • 788647e98f syncs: fix AtomicValue for interface kinds Joe Tsai 2024-04-30 13:22:46 -0700
  • 5314fe28c6
    Merge 4da7a50c4b into 44aa809cb0 Maisem Ali 2024-04-30 19:33:25 +0000
  • 3f8e1377e5 cmd/k8s-operator: optionally update dnsrecords Configmap with DNS records for proxies. Irbe Krumina 2024-02-02 18:54:53 +0000
  • 44aa809cb0
    cmd/{k8s-nameserver,k8s-operator},k8s-operator: add a kube nameserver, make operator deploy it (#11919) Irbe Krumina 2024-04-30 20:18:23 +0100
  • 34c71c10c3 ipn/ipnlocal: reset the dialPlan only when the URL is unchanged Andrew Dunham 2024-04-30 15:09:12 -0400
  • c2f8b8d092 code review feedback Irbe Krumina 2024-04-30 19:15:15 +0100
  • 1fe073098c
    Reset dial plan when switching profile (#11933) Shaw Drastin 2024-05-01 01:42:49 +0800
  • 675c0763b7 Reset dial plan when switching profile Shaw Drastin 2024-05-01 00:57:47 +0800
  • a47ce618bd
    net/tstun: implement env var for disabling UDP GRO on Linux (#11924) Jordan Whited 2024-04-30 09:14:02 -0700
  • ec04c677c0
    api.md: add documentation for new split DNS endpoints (#11922) Mario Minardi 2024-04-30 09:42:33 -0600
  • 933240af56
    net/tstun: implement env var for disabling UDP GRO on Linux Jordan Whited 2024-04-29 11:55:57 -0700
  • fcfffb2e02 cmd/k8s-operator,k8s-operator,go.{mod,sum}: make individual proxy images/image pull policies configurable irbekrm/docim Irbe Krumina 2024-04-30 11:50:56 +0100
  • a41f7db57a chore: fix typos hugo-syn 2024-04-30 10:52:13 +0200
  • f902ff0070
    Merge 4de947ce7e into 7ba8f03936 Patrick O'Doherty 2024-04-29 15:14:03 -0700
  • 7ba8f03936
    ipn/ipnlocal: fix TestOnTailnetDefaultAutoUpdate on unsupported platforms (#11921) Andrew Lytvynov 2024-04-29 13:35:29 -0700
  • a1275ab16b api.md: add documentation for new split DNS endpoints Mario Minardi 2024-04-29 11:59:21 -0600
  • 7d9c3f9897
    cmd/k8s-operator/deploy/manifests: check if IPv6 module is loaded before using it (#11867) Irbe Krumina 2024-04-29 21:12:23 +0100
  • d02f1be46a
    scripts/installer.sh: enable Alpine community repo if needed (#11837) Andrew Lytvynov 2024-04-29 12:23:46 -0700
  • 5254f6de06
    tailcfg: add suggest exit node UI node attribute (#11918) Claire Wang 2024-04-29 15:20:52 -0400
  • ce5c80d0fe
    clientupdate: exec systemctl instead of using dbus to restart (#11923) Andrew Lytvynov 2024-04-29 12:16:40 -0700
  • a3062e06f9
    ipn/ipnlocal: fix TestOnTailnetDefaultAutoUpdate on unsupported platforms Andrew Lytvynov 2024-04-29 11:21:40 -0700
  • e23dd4a2c8
    clientupdate: exec systemctl instead of using dbus to restart Andrew Lytvynov 2024-04-29 11:54:27 -0700
  • 0400224cf2 tailcfg: add suggest exit node UI node attribute Add node attribute to determine whether or not to show suggested exit node in UI. Updates tailscale/corp#19515 Claire Wang 2024-04-29 14:54:09 -0400
  • cbd8d5d645 cmd/k8s-operator/deploy/manifests: check if IPv6 module is loaded before using it Irbe Krumina 2024-04-24 21:21:54 +0100
  • 6a0fbacc28 appc: setting AdvertiseRoutes explicitly discards app connector routes Fran Bull 2024-04-15 11:30:00 -0700
  • c27dc1ca31 appc: unadvertise routes when reconfiguring app connector Fran Bull 2024-04-15 10:16:02 -0700
  • fea2e73bc1 appc: write discovered domains to StateStore Fran Bull 2024-04-12 13:34:14 -0700
  • 1bd1b387b2 appc: add flag shouldStoreRoutes and controlknob for it Fran Bull 2024-04-11 10:12:13 -0700
  • 79836e7bfd appc: add RouteInfo struct and persist it to StateStore Fran Bull 2024-04-11 14:06:12 -0700
  • 68555fa28b appc: setting AdvertiseRoutes explicitly discards app connector routes Fran Bull 2024-04-15 11:30:00 -0700
  • b52834c76b appc: unadvertise routes when reconfiguring app connector Fran Bull 2024-04-15 10:16:02 -0700
  • 78ae2a11c7 appc: write discovered domains to StateStore Fran Bull 2024-04-12 13:34:14 -0700
  • 5b2e864ddd appc: add flag shouldStoreRoutes and controlknob for it Fran Bull 2024-04-11 10:12:13 -0700
  • b2b49cb3d5 wgengine/wgcfg/nmcfg: skip expired peers Andrew Dunham 2024-04-19 15:35:34 -0400
  • 21ced0f7f6 cmd/{k8s-operator,k8s-nameserver}: generate DNSConfig CRD for charts, append to static manifests Irbe Krumina 2024-03-10 23:09:10 +0000
  • 54a1381192 cmd/k8s-operator,k8s-operator: optionally reconcile nameserver resources Irbe Krumina 2024-03-10 22:49:38 +0000
  • f82dfcc106 cmd/k8s-operator/deploy/crds,k8s-operator: add DNSConfig CustomResource Definition Irbe Krumina 2024-03-10 22:44:48 +0000
  • 28bbe1c036 cmd/k8s-nameserver,k8s-operator: add a nameserver that can resolve ts.net DNS names in cluster. Irbe Krumina 2024-02-02 12:19:25 +0000
  • 8fcac10029
    drive/driveimpl: rewrite text/html Content-Type to text/plain ox/corp-19592 Percy Wegmann 2024-04-29 11:55:20 -0500
  • 74c399483c
    api.md: explicitly set content-type headers in POST CURL examples (#11916) Mario Minardi 2024-04-29 10:25:52 -0600
  • 1452faf510
    cmd/containerboot,kube,ipn/store/kubestore: allow interactive login on kube, check Secret create perms, allow empty state Secret (#11326) Irbe Krumina 2024-04-29 17:03:48 +0100
  • 725238d2a7 api.md: explicitly set content-type headers in POST CURL examples Mario Minardi 2024-04-29 09:48:29 -0600
  • 3d92b01544
    .github: bump golangci/golangci-lint-action from 3.6.0 to 5.0.0 dependabot[bot] 2024-04-29 11:46:16 +0000
  • e09b94ed2f
    .github: bump peter-evans/create-pull-request from 5.0.1 to 6.0.5 dependabot/github_actions/peter-evans/create-pull-request-6.0.5 dependabot[bot] 2024-04-29 11:46:02 +0000
  • 1e6cdb7d86 api.md: fix missing links after move of device posture Kristoffer Dalby 2024-04-25 16:46:10 +0200
  • 62c8ed7d73
    WIP ox/11954-3 Percy Wegmann 2024-04-28 20:57:00 -0500
  • 6537f351a1
    ssh/tailss: add integration test Percy Wegmann 2024-04-28 10:42:10 -0500